The No. 20 Lindenwood wrestling team dominated Central Missouri 40-4 on Wednesday night in Hyland Arena.
Danny Swan dominated his opponent with a 17-1 tech fall in the 141-pound match.

Nate Trepanier wrestled up in the 157-pound weight class to earn his first victory in that division since the Midwest Classic on December 16th in Indianapolis, Ind.
The Lions improve to 5-5 on the season and 1-3 in the MIAA as they will conclude their home schedule against Fort Hays State on Sunday at 2 p.m. in Hyland Arena.
